NRSD LULC Mapping Training

Hanoi, Vietnam, April 13-21, 2017

Vietnam's National Remote Sensing Department (NRSD) requested technical assistance from SilvaCarbon to help implement the joint NRSD and Department of Meteorology, Hydrology, and Climate Change (DMHCC) project on “National GHG inventory of 2016 in LULUCF sector in support of the development of the national communication and Vietnam’s contribution to UNFCCC.”

The objectives of this training were to:

  1. Train NRSD’s team on how to fuse spectral bands or optimize spectral band combination, which enables proper interpretation and classification of different land covers;
  2. Train in the development of basemaps and a database in support of GHG inventory of agriculture and LULUCF sectors, which include: national land use/land cover map, climate map by ecological regions and soil map in line with IPCC guidelines for change monitoring (activity data and emission) of 2 time periods between 2006 and 2016;
  3. Derive remote sensing based mapping data to extract to textfile for use in ALU for estimation of emission and removal of LULUCF for 2016.
